The HT3062E battery protection chip that I have been using in my Fluffbug #robot is now impossible to buy, so I sat down and designed version 6 of the PCB using the alternative DW07D chip for battery protection. I also used the opportunity to add a mosfet to the speaker, and some handles at the top for easier attaching of accessories.Also, I replaced the broken servos in one of the prototypes with orange ones, and it looks pretty neat.

Mostly assembled the version six of the Fluffbug #robot. This time I decided to use the SG92R servos, as they are a bit stronger while being the same weight. I still need to connect and cut the cables. Also visible is the camera shield, which still requires testing.

I got the little guy walking, but I had to short the new battery protection chip DW07D, as it seems to panic and cut off the battery when the servos start moving together. I couldn't find its exact current limit, but I will see if I can tune it somehow.

Replacing one resistor next to the battery protection chip fixed the problems triggered by the overcurrent condition. The protection is still there, just requires a greater voltage drop on the battery to be triggered.

Today I had a little time and energy to do coding, so I rewrote the gait code for fluffbug using asyncio. It's still not great, with hard-coded waits everywhere, but it's a step forward, and now that it's all asyncio tasks, it's easy to add support for a screen displaying animated face while walking, or some sensors. In the future, I want a function that will estimate the movement time of the servo, and do the waiting automatically.
